**Alert: Nightly search reindex failed or exceeded SLA**

This alert fires when the Lanternquill nightly reindex job either exits non-zero or runs past its four-hour window. Stale indexes degrade search relevance across the Marrowfield catalog, so treat this as high priority even though user impact is gradual. Check the job logs first, then verify shard health before retrying. The full runbook is maintained here:

operations page: https://confluence.qorvelsys.internal/browse/projects/projects/f004fd0d

# Quotas & Limits: The Pickleford Stale-Cache Postmortem

Quick recap for the sync: last Tuesday, Pickleford's edge cache kept serving week-old pricing because our invalidation queue hit its quota and silently dropped messages. Fun! We've since bumped the quotas and added a hard alert when the queue passes 80% depth. To keep us all honest, the new limits are documented here and enforced in config. Current values are as follows.

tuning table, yajog-yahof:
BUDGETS = {
    "lamvan": 303,
    "wenox": 460,
    "fenvan": 525,
}

## Changelog — Ticktrace 1.9

### Renamed: DRIFT_API_TOKEN
During the cron drift investigation we found plugins confusing this variable with the metrics token, so it has been renamed to indicate it authorizes drift-report uploads specifically. Plugin authors must read the new name from 1.9 onward; the old name is ignored without warning. Sample env files in the SDK are updated. In your deployment env file, the drift-report upload secret is set on the next line.

env line for fawef-taguf: VAULT_KEY13=a9695905a9a90